igubal spherical detectable plastic bearings

Tuesday, 05 August, 2014 | Supplied by: Treotham Automation Pty Ltd


The igubal range of self-aligning bearing elements, completely made of plastic, has been extended to include spherical detectable bearings.

Both the housing and spherical ball are detectable by standard metal-detection systems to pick up even the smallest particles of the bearings if failure was to occur.

The bearings are easy to install, adjust to all angular misalignments, and can replace traditional metal bearings, which can weigh up to 80% more than igubal.

The bearings are dry running, unaffected by dirt and dust, operate well in liquids and a variety of chemicals and are corrosion resistant. They are suited to run in temperatures from -20 to 80°C and are able to absorb very high forces due to their vibration-dampening properties. They also possess high levels of compressive strength and elasticity.
